Description
Table mnet_host saves the wwwroot and IP address of the local site. If either of these change, mnet breaks. Either this information should come from config.php, or there should be a way of updating it (short of editing the database) when moving the site.

Actually it's more complicated than that.
The wwwroot is embedded inside the ssl key. If you move the site you have to also regenerate your local key, and repeer it with all your peers.
There isn't a good way to solve that and still be secure. You could broadcast to all your peered hosts that you have a new key, but that's pretty insecure.
